同義詞
  • three-way

    more informal; common in everyday speech about relationships or agreements

  • tripartite

    formal; used mainly in law, politics, and business documents

  • trilateral

    used especially for agreements or discussions involving three countries or large organizations

用法筆記

Most common in attributive position before abstract nouns such as relationship, partnership, arrangement, alliance, or trade. Unlike sense 1, this sense is rarely used predicatively.
